Skip to content

add try-state check for staking roles -- staker cannot be nominator a…#9034

Merged
kianenigma merged 6 commits intomasterfrom
kiz-try-state-for-min-bonds
Jul 2, 2025
Merged

add try-state check for staking roles -- staker cannot be nominator a…#9034
kianenigma merged 6 commits intomasterfrom
kiz-try-state-for-min-bonds

Conversation

@kianenigma
Copy link
Contributor

@kianenigma kianenigma requested review from Ank4n and sigurpol June 30, 2025 08:49
@kianenigma kianenigma requested a review from a team as a code owner June 30, 2025 08:49
@kianenigma kianenigma added the R0-no-crate-publish-required The change does not require any crates to be re-published. label Jun 30, 2025
@paritytech-workflow-stopper
Copy link

All GitHub workflows were cancelled due to failure one of the required jobs.
Failed workflow url: https://github.com/paritytech/polkadot-sdk/actions/runs/15968301091
Failed job name: test-linux-stable

@kianenigma
Copy link
Contributor Author

/cmd prdoc --bump patch

@kianenigma kianenigma enabled auto-merge June 30, 2025 18:16
@kianenigma
Copy link
Contributor Author

/cmd help

@github-actions
Copy link
Contributor

github-actions bot commented Jul 1, 2025

Command "help" has started 🚀 See logs here

@github-actions
Copy link
Contributor

github-actions bot commented Jul 1, 2025

Command "help" has failed ❌! See logs here

@kianenigma kianenigma added this pull request to the merge queue Jul 1, 2025
@github-merge-queue github-merge-queue bot removed this pull request from the merge queue due to failed status checks Jul 1, 2025
@kianenigma kianenigma added this pull request to the merge queue Jul 2, 2025
Merged via the queue into master with commit 1bb1656 Jul 2, 2025
240 of 241 checks passed
@kianenigma kianenigma deleted the kiz-try-state-for-min-bonds branch July 2, 2025 15:39
ordian added a commit that referenced this pull request Jul 24, 2025
* master: (91 commits)
  Add extra information to the harmless error logs during validate_transaction (#9047)
  `sp-tracing`: Remove `test-utils` feature (#9063)
  add try-state check for staking roles -- staker cannot be nominator a… (#9034)
  net/discovery: File persistence for `AddrCache` (#8839)
  dispute-coordinator: handle race with offchain disabling (#9050)
  Align parameters for `EventEmitter::emit_sent_event` (#9057)
  Fetch parent block `api_version` (#9059)
  [XCM Precompile] Rename functions and improve docs in the Solidity interface (#9023)
  Cleanup and improvements for `ControlledValidatorIndices` (#8896)
  reenable 0001-parachains-pvf (#9046)
  Add optional auto-rebag within on-idle (#8684)
  Fix flaxy 0003-block-building-warp-sync test - one more approach (#8974)
  [Staking] [AHM] Fixes insufficient slashing of nominators (and some other small issues). (#8937)
  chore: Bump bounded-collections dep (#9004)
  XCMP and DMP improvements (#8860)
  EPMB/unsigned: fixed multi-page winner computation (#8987)
  Always send full parent header, not only hash, part of collation response (#8939)
  revive: Precompiles should return dummy code when queried (#9001)
  Fix confusing log messages in network protocol behaviour (#8819)
  Fix pallet_migrations benchmark when FailedMigrationHandler emits events (#8694)
  ...
alvicsam pushed a commit that referenced this pull request Oct 17, 2025
#9034)

Tiny follow-up to
https://github.com/paritytech/polkadot-sdk/pull/8701/files

---------

Co-authored-by: cmd[bot] <41898282+github-actions[bot]@users.noreply.github.com>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

R0-no-crate-publish-required The change does not require any crates to be re-published.

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ants